There are 447.68 miles from Alexandria to Detroit Metropolitan Airport (DTW) in northeast direction and 530 miles (852.95 kilometers) by car, following the I-75 N route.

Alexandria and DTW Airport are 8 hours 44 mins far apart, if you drive non-stop .

This is the fastest route from Alexandria, TN to DTW Airport. The halfway point is Verona, KY.
